Understanding the Role of Executive Recruitment Services
Executive recruitment services specialize in finding high-level talent for organizations. Unlike traditional recruitment, these services focus on leaders who can have a strategic impact. Recruiters do not simply fill open positions. They work closely with clients to understand business goals, company culture, and the type of leadership required.
They also maintain extensive networks of qualified executives. These networks include passive candidates who are not actively applying for jobs but may consider the right opportunity. This access is one of the key advantages of working with executive recruitment services. Businesses gain connections they might not be able to reach on their own.
How Recruiters Identify Top Talent
Executive recruiters use a combination of research, networking, and technology to identify candidates. They analyze industries, track career trajectories, and evaluate leadership performance. By doing this, they ensure that only highly qualified individuals enter the conversation.
In addition, recruiters assess candidates for cultural fit and strategic alignment. They consider how a candidate’s leadership style, experience, and values match the company’s needs. This thorough evaluation reduces the risk of hiring a leader who is not aligned with the organization’s goals.
The Value of Confidentiality in Executive Searches
Many executive roles require discretion. Companies often do not want to announce leadership changes publicly until a candidate is finalized. Executive recruitment services manage this confidentiality. They reach out to candidates privately, handle communication, and maintain sensitive information.
This level of discretion benefits both the company and the candidate. Organizations can continue operating without distraction, and executives can explore opportunities without impacting their current role. Recruiters act as trusted intermediaries throughout the process.
Streamlining the Hiring Process
Executive recruitment services streamline the hiring process by managing time-consuming tasks. They schedule interviews, coordinate feedback, and handle documentation. This allows company leadership to focus on strategy and operations rather than logistics.
Additionally, recruiters filter candidates before presenting them. They conduct initial screenings, verify qualifications, and discuss expectations. As a result, businesses only meet candidates who are well-matched to the role. This efficiency saves time and ensures that the hiring process moves forward smoothly.
Negotiating Offers and Closing the Deal
Once the ideal candidate is identified, executive recruitment services assist in negotiating offers. They provide guidance on compensation, benefits, and other terms to create agreements that satisfy both parties. Recruiters understand market standards and can ensure offers are competitive.
They also help manage expectations on both sides. Clear communication reduces misunderstandings and ensures the candidate feels valued. With recruiters guiding this stage, companies are more likely to secure top talent without unnecessary delays or complications.
Supporting Long-Term Relationships
Executive recruitment services do not end after a placement. Many firms maintain ongoing relationships with executives and organizations. They track career developments, stay informed about potential opportunities, and offer guidance for future hiring needs.
This long-term approach benefits businesses by creating a continuous talent pipeline. Companies can plan for succession, growth, and leadership changes more effectively. Recruiters become trusted advisors who support both immediate and long-term talent strategy.
